Development of Reflux Vapor Trap for Sodium Cooled Fast Breeder Reactor, (I)

Basic Performance Tests

, , &
Pages 997-1004 | Received 29 Jan 1982, Published online: 15 Mar 2012
 

Abstract

With the view of obtaining basic data required for designing durable reflux vapor traps of high performance for use in sodium-cooled FBR's, experiments were conducted to (a) select a suitable packing, and (b) to examine the effect brought on trapping performance by changing the gas flow rate, packing material, packing density and trap outlet temperature. The results indicated that:

(1) As trap packing, plane weave stainless steel mesh proved to ensure lower pressure drop through trap.

(2) Using the plane weave mesh packing, and with the trap outlet temperature kept at 130°C, the reflux vapor trap efficiency was found to exceed 99.6% in the range of vapor trap gas velocity below 1.3 m/s, and packing density below 0.07 g/cc. The efficiency decreased at outlet temperatures above 130°C.
